The Chinese Communist Celebration has actually achieved something uncommon in U.S. politics nowadays: joining Democrats and Republicans around a typical opponent. Sadly, crazy issue about Chinese impact threatens America’s capability to draw in the leading skill it requires to keep worldwide management in science and college.
The damage brought on by the Department of Justice’s now-disbanded China Effort still resounds. Created to counter financial espionage and nationwide security dangers from China, it resulted– in many cases– in scientists and academics of Chinese descent being positioned under home arrest or removed in handcuffs on charges of concealing ties to China, cases that ended in acquittal or were later on dropped.
The program led to couple of prosecutions prior to being closed down in 2015. However it overthrew lives and professions, and developed an environment of worry. Some ethnic Chinese researchers disproportionately feel that their ethnic culture and connections to China prevent their expert development and their opportunities of getting– and determination to make an application for– research study financing in the United States. A study of researchers of Chinese descent at American universities launched in 2015 discovered that considerable portions of participants felt unwanted in the United States, with 86 percent stating the present environment makes it harder for the United States to draw in leading global trainees than it was 5 years back.
This ought to be triggering alarm bells in Washington. Economic and military benefit is contingent on exceptional science, innovation and development— and the competitors for skill is worldwide.
Research Studies program that the very best science is typically done by global research study groups, most likely since scientists can pick from a wider variety of possible partners. When we dissuade global cooperation in the lack of clear issues about nationwide security, we restrict the swimming pool of possible partners, possibly damaging the research study.
This is particularly real when it concerns China, which has actually ended up being a clinical power.
China was 2nd just to the United States in overall costs on research study and advancement since 2018, according to figures from the Company for Economic Cooperation and Advancement. Chinese publishing of research study documents has actually grown, by one step, to 25 percent in 2020 from less than 1 percent of the worldwide overall prior to 1990.
This work is of progressively high quality. According to some estimations, Chinese documents are mentioned (an indicator of a paper’s effect) by academics in their own work regularly than those of any other nation. Academics likewise pick their partners based upon who can best assist them to advance their work, and scientists at American universities have actually for years selected co-authors from China more than from any other nation, according to a report from the National Science Structure. Concerns have actually been raised about Chinese scholastic scams and low-grade patents, however more work is required to evaluate how extensive those issues are.
Issues over scholastic cooperation with China are genuine. Under the Chinese design, civilian companies and services are often required to support the nation’s military device. I have actually heard enough to think that some Chinese trainees in America might be reporting what occurs in class to representatives in China which some Chinese scholars might have concealed arrangements to communicate what they have actually discovered back house.
China’s federal government has actually added to the degeneration of scholastic cooperation. Carrying out research study in China is more difficult than it has actually remained in years since of an increased focus there on ideology and nationwide security, an ever-widening scope of subjects considered delicate, reducing scholastic liberty and, till they were ended last December, the smothering result of almost 3 years of zero-Covid policies.
However let’s not race China to the bottom. If America stops working to draw in leading global research study skill, that hurts U.S. potential customers for clinical development and, eventually, American financial and nationwide strength.
There is no doubt that present scenarios require more openness amongst scholars. Universities require to lead this modification, where scholars pay higher attention to the ramifications of working together with foreign researchers. For instance, Sweden has actually established structures for evaluating dangers through more structured due diligence of research study partners, consisting of evaluating issues that may develop when working together with researchers from authoritarian nations.
However we can’t let this obstruct of guaranteeing that the United States stays the very best location on the planet to study science, innovation, engineering and mathematics and lures graduates from abroad to stay here after finishing their degrees. Yet the variety of U.S. visas approved to Chinese trainees has dropped To reverse this, visa procedures ought to be structured, stockpiles cleared and talented people offered broadened chances to acquire permits. America is training and informing a few of the world’s brightest individuals; we require to get more of them and keep them here.
Similarly, more Americans require to be finding out about China. The variety of American trainees studying in China was currently decreasing from a peak of about 15,000 in 2011-12; throughout the pandemic that dropped to less than 400. China is, and will continue to be, a crucial worldwide gamer; comprehending its internal characteristics will be necessary for individuals running in a variety of fields. Yet we are at danger of having a whole generation of Americans who understand little about China.
We ought to instantly reboot the Fulbright program in China, which sent out countless Chinese and Americans in between the 2 nations for research study and discovering till it was stopped throughout the Trump administration, and increase federal financing for Chinese research studies programs at our universities.
Keeping American college available to the world is not about assisting China to end up being strong, nor ought to we misguide ourselves about Beijing’s intents. It has to do with exhibiting self-confidence in the strength and virtues of our system to make sure that America stays the very best nation on the planet for discovering and research study.
